Growing Business - Strengthening Community
           

Nonprofits are big business in Virginia and a robust source of jobs, spending and tax revenue. A recently updated report from John  

Hopkins University confirms the major economic presence of Virginia nonprofits as the third largest employer among Virginia's industries amassing $39.2 billion in revenues and $37.9 billion in spending.Building and strengthening the business of doing good is the goal of the new Business Resource Network and its inaugural event this Thursday, the Nonprofit Resource Fair. This event will provide a unique opportunity for shared learning and networking among professionals from nonprofit organizations and local businesses benefiting both sectors. Nonprofits that partner with business succeed in furthering their mission, developing resources, strengthening programs, and thriving in a competitive market. Similarly, businesses that partner with nonprofits see increases in customer preference, improved employee morale, greater brand identity and stronger corporate culture.
